There’s a reason gut health keeps coming back into the conversation - the body has a way of forcing the conversation when it’s been ignored long enough.
In this episode of Wellness Your Way Podcast, Megan Lyons and I skip the wellness buzzwords and get into the uncomfortable truth: a lot of people aren’t “mysteriously” inflamed, exhausted, anxious, or reactive — their gut has been under chronic stress for years, and it’s finally showing up in symptoms they can’t muscle through anymore.
We talk about what leaky gut actually means (and why it’s not a fringe diagnosis), how food sensitivities are often created by stress and inflammation, not something you’re doomed with forever, and why digestion is one of the first systems to shut down when the body feels under pressure.
This isn’t a perfect-diet episode. It’s a physiology-first conversation about digestion, immunity, hormones, and why the body stops whispering and starts shouting when no one’s listening.

The Bigger TakeawayGut health isn’t about obsessing over every bite or eliminating everything you enjoy.
It’s about creating an internal environment where digestion works, inflammation calms down, and the nervous system isn’t constantly bracing for impact.
When the gut is compromised, the body doesn’t whisper — it compensates… until it can’t.
This episode is an invitation to stop treating symptoms in isolation and start looking at the system underneath them.
